Overview
ISO 4205:2016 specifies the dimensions and tolerances (in millimetres) for 90° countersinks with parallel shanks and solid pilots for general use. This third edition (2016) is a minor revision of the earlier edition and adds an informative annex that maps the standard’s designations to the ISO 13399 cutting‑tool data model. The standard provides diagrammatic geometry (Figure 1) and a table of dimensional ranges and associated tolerances for commonly used cutting diameters.
Key topics and requirements
- Scope and intent: Defines the geometric parameters and tolerance classes for 90° countersinks intended for general machining applications.
- Dimensional data: Cutting diameter categories (e.g., 2 ≤ d ≤ 3.15 up to 12.5 < d ≤ 20) with specified pilot and shank diameters and relevant lengths; tolerances are given per the nominal size ranges.
- Tolerancing reference: Uses ISO 286-2 for tolerance classes and limit deviations on linear sizes (holes and shafts).
- Design notation and data exchange: Annex A provides a direct relationship between ISO 4205 designations (cutting diameter, guide pilot diameter, connection/shank diameter, overall length, etc.) and ISO 13399 property symbols (e.g., DC, GPD, DCONMS, OAL, LS, GPL, SIG).
- Illustrative figure: Figure 1 is provided as a diagrammatic guide to the dimensions (note: figure is illustrative and not a detailed design drawing).

Related standards
- ISO 286-2 - Tolerance classes and limit deviations for holes and shafts (referenced for tolerancing)
- ISO 4206 - Counterbores with parallel shanks and solid pilots (related tooling family)
- ISO 13399 (all parts) - Cutting tool data representation and exchange (Annex A maps ISO 4205 designations to ISO 13399 symbols)
